How to use Journaling as a Therapeutic Tool || Mental Health & Wellness

Journaling can be used as a cheap and quick therapeutic tool. A tool to process your thoughts and feelings deeper, to rediscover yourself, and to take steps towards changing your life.
I am a HUGE advocate for journaling and use it for myself regularly. Journaling with pen & paper has a huge impact on how we can process these thoughts and feelings within us.
Writing is a way to grab hold of your thinking & train yourself to think a little bit slower to process those thoughts.

    Scott, a journaling practice takes a bit of time to create and get the flow going. What really helps is attaching it to a habit you already have and journal for 5 mins - it can really make a difference. If you're struggling with prompts - one of my go-to prompts is "fear shows up for me when..." or pick any emotion or thought that seems persistent to explore. Thanks for leaving a comment, Cecilia

    Hello! This is a common fear for many people - if you live with people, it can come down to setting some boundaries around privacy. If it's a general fear that someone will read it and judge you for it - aren't you allowed to have your private thoughts that might seem 'irrational' at times? Them judging you is a reflection of them and not you. We all have thoughts and feelings in the moment that may not reflect how we always think and feel and journaling is a way to process them and move through them. Don't let fear keep you from journaling!
